When it comes to ensuring safety for children and pets round swimming pools, putting in a fence is a vital step. However, many householders discover themselves making frequent pool fence errors that might compromise safety and lead to authorized challenges (Elegant glass designs for external staircases Sunshine Coast Qld). Recognizing these pitfalls is vital for a secure and compliant pool space
One frequent error is neglecting the local regulations. Each state or municipality has specific codes governing pool safety options. Failing to familiarize oneself with these regulations may find yourself in fines and the necessity for pricey modifications. Often, homeowners believe they'll design their very own safety measures without considering authorized requirements. This overconfidence can result in critical implications, especially if an incident happens.
Another widespread mistake is insufficient fence height. Many regulations specify a minimum height for pool fences to discourage children from climbing over them. A fence that does not meet these height necessities can easily be scaled by curious children. Installing a fence that's too low poses a significant risk, as it compromises the very purpose of getting a barrier around the pool.

The sort of material used for the fence also plays a major position in safety. Choosing supplies which are weak or susceptible to break can result in fast deterioration and a compromised boundary. Wooden fences, whereas aesthetically pleasing, might rot or warp over time, creating gaps that youngsters can slip through. Opting for extra durable supplies like aluminum or vinyl can improve the longevity and effectiveness of the pool barrier.
Another often-overlooked side is the position of the fence. Some homeowners mistakenly position the fence far enough away from the water’s edge to make the pool area look bigger or extra inviting. This can be misleading, as it may enable for simple access to the pool area from within the yard. A fence should ideally enclose the pool closely to prevent access instantly from inside the home.

Additionally, the gates in pool fences are crucial for safety. Common mistakes include using gates that don't self-close or self-latch. These options are important to forestall kids from wandering freely into the pool area. Failing to install a gate that properly features can render the whole fence ineffective. Regular maintenance checks on these gates must be a precedence to ensure they proceed to be secure over time.
Maintenance of the fence itself is one other space typically neglected. Over time, fences can develop weaknesses, whether from wear and tear or environmental components. Homeowners generally neglect that fences require regular inspections and repairs to remain safe. An missed gap or crack in the fence's materials can present an unimpeded entry point to small children or pets.
Some individuals may select to install a fence themselves without sufficient knowledge. DIY initiatives may be cost-effective but usually result in subpar installations. Incorrect measurements or improper anchoring could cause fences to turn into unstable, making them less dependable. When it comes to safety installations such as pool fences, consulting with professionals is a prudent alternative to ensure confidence within the job accomplished.

Transparency in design can be essential. Using materials that obstruct visibility can create blind spots, leaving parents unaware of their children's actions near the poolside. A fence should allow caregivers to keep up sightlines to the pool area at all times. Using transparent supplies or designs that don't hinder the view ensures steady supervision.
The option of additional safety features can be ignored. Many householders may think that merely putting in a fence is enough for safety. However, including alarms to the gates or utilizing pool covers can significantly enhance protecting measures. These extra options can function deterrents, alerting owners and caregivers to unauthorized access or potential risks.

How excessive ought to a pool fence be?
The recommended height for a pool fence is at least four ft. This height is usually required by regulation to forestall unauthorized access by young children and pets.

Are gaps underneath the pool fence a problem?
Yes, gaps underneath the fence shouldn't exceed four inches. Larger gaps can enable children or pets to slip underneath, compromising safety.

Should pool gates be self-closing?
Absolutely. Self-closing gates that latch securely are essential for preventing unauthorized access to the pool space, especially by younger youngsters.

Can I rely solely on a pool cover for safety?
No, pool covers aren't reliable safety barriers. They should complement, not substitute, a correct fence designed to maintain kids and pets safe.
